How to Find Attributes of Objects in Active Directory

Published by Sam Yang on May 8, 2012 | 4 Responses

If a developer wants to do something in AD, getting/ modifying AD attributes are common operations. Instead of checking attributes of AD object through coding, Active Directory provides an advanced feature “Attribute Editor” for developers to check them. 1. Open Active Directory Users and Computers and select “Advanced Features“ under “View” tab.

Using Content Deployment to Copy One Site Collection to Another in SharePoint 2010

Published by KC Young on April 27, 2012 | Leave a response

In simple terms, Content Deployment in SharePoint 2010 is used to deploy the content from one site to another site. We can set the content deployment jobs (incoming and outgoing) using SharePoint Central Administration 2010. The two-farm topology is a standard Internet site topology and is typical of topologies that are used to publish an […]

Manage Information Management Policy Settings in SharePoint 2010 Document Library

Published by Wendy on April 18, 2012 | Leave a response

Information Management Policy (IM Policy) allows list administrators to define specific policies for content stored within the library. These policies ensure content adherence to corresponding compliance rules that have been defined for the library. This blog will provide you with a rough idea about the Information Management Policy settings in the SharePoint 2010 Document Library.
